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
49 721 14199382146
60 563
60 563
2919743 0187773545 922418
All about undefined
Interested in learning more?
60 563
2919743 0187773545 922418
See more
684252 6082134 057
10 61879462660 72 729 276220
See more
02659777 6269839
43785872 94 737652575
See more